An epigrammatic impression of the most recent developments in analytical views of degradation profiling of pharmaceuticals, including active pharmaceutical ingredient, is described in this article. To give details on the processes and end results of degradation. This article offers a road map for when and how to conduct studies, helpful tools for planning tough scientific experiments, and instructions on how to record and disseminate results in order to achieve development and regulatory objectives. According to ICH recommendations, some factors might cause degradation, such as light, oxidation, dry heat, acidic, basic, hydrolysis, etc. The forced degradation experiments are best illustrated by ICH Q1A, QIB, and Q2B. The strategic ideas and developments in forced degradation studies are reviewed in this article. Studies on degradation are conducted at every stage of pharmaceutical research, production, and packaging. It aims to determine whether a method is stability indicating by assessing the degradation profile of an appropriate API and/or medications.
